Power BI offre un vaste éventail d’options pour les développeurs. Cela va de l’incorporation dans des visuels personnalisés aux jeux de données en streaming.

Incorporation

Le service Power BI et Power BI Embedded dans Azure s’assemblent afin d’offrir une seule API pour incorporer vos tableaux de bord et rapports. Cela signifie que vous disposez d’une surface d’API, d’un ensemble cohérent de fonctionnalités et de l’accès aux dernières fonctionnalités de Power BI telles que des tableaux de bord, des passerelles et des espaces de travail d’application lors de l’incorporation de votre contenu. Pour plus d’informations, voir Incorporation avec Power BI.

Éléments visuels personnalisés

Les visuels personnalisés vous permettent de créer vos propres visuels à utiliser dans les rapports Power BI. Les visuels personnalisés sont écrits en TypeScript, qui est un sur-ensemble de JavaScript prenant en charge certaines fonctionnalités avancées et un accès en avant-première aux fonctionnalités de ES6/ES7. Les styles de visuels sont gérés à l’aide de feuilles de style en cascade (CSS). Pour votre facilité, nous utilisons le précompilateur LESS qui prend en charge certaines fonctionnalités avancées, telles que l’imbrication, les variables, les mixins, les conditions, les boucles, etc. Si vous ne souhaitez pas utiliser ces fonctionnalités, vous pouvez simplement écrire une feuille de style CSS brute dans le fichier LESS.

Pour plus d’informations sur la façon de développer et publier un visuel personnalisé, voir Publier des visuels personnalisés dans l’Office Store.

Transmettre des données à Power BI

Vous pouvez utiliser l’API Power BI pour envoyer des données dans un jeu de données. Cela vous permet d’ajouter une ligne à une table à l’intérieur d’un jeu de données. Les nouvelles données peuvent ensuite être reflétées dans des vignettes sur un tableau de bord et dans des visuels à l’intérieur de votre rapport.

Pour plus d’informations, voir Transmettre des données à un tableau de bord.

Étapes suivantes

Incorporation avec Power BI
Comment migrer le contenu d’une collection d’espaces de travail Power BI Embedded vers Power BI
Dépôt Git d’API JavaScript
Dépôt Git de C# pour Power BI
Publier des visuels personnalisés dans l’Office Store
Dépôt Git de visuels Power BI
Exemple de JavaScript incorporé
API Power BI sur Apiary
Livre blanc sur Power BI Premium
D’autres questions ? Posez vos questions à la communauté Power BI